GEF UNIDO11 February 2014: The UN Industrial Development Organization (UNIDO) convened a training on hazardous waste management and inspection of PCBs for officials from Mongolia, from 20-24 January 2014, in Prague, Czech Republic. The training was part of the Global Environment Facility (GEF) funded project on ‘Capacity building for environmentally sound management of PCBs in Mongolia,’ which is currently being implemented by UNIDO.

According to UNIDO, Mongolian officers responsible for hazardous waste management and policy development require capacity-building in the fields of boarder control, inspection and enforcement of legislation. The training allowed participants to learn from Czech experiences and to develop an understanding of key principles of control and inspection of hazardous wastes in the EU. [IISD RS Sources]
